Output a1e866ae84be13d33311756c1f303101e14f8ca16192e337d96cb318722d4737:9

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adf509f9625c0237fa24aa578cedaa2e35c8c2f6 OP_EQUAL
address
3HYpNLSNLqqUHEfrtmxZo9otfuqAHrhVYW
transaction
a1e866ae84be13d33311756c1f303101e14f8ca16192e337d96cb318722d4737
spent
true